鼻骨数字化摄影中EVP的应用

摘    要:目的:探讨EVP软件在鼻骨侧位数字化影像处理中的价值。方法:对50例鼻骨侧位数字化影像应用不同的EVP技术参数进行影像处理,由2名放射科经验丰富的医生对处理后的影像进行评估,评价影像对鼻骨整体、周边软组织及前颅窝骨质的显示情况。结果:50例经过优化参数的EVP软件处理影像与原始EVP参数影像及非EVP影像对鼻骨整体显示清晰的分别为44例、35例和19例(χ^2=28.32,P〈0.01);对鼻骨周边软组织显示清晰的分别为41例、31例和12例(χ^2=35.23,P〈0.01);对前颅窝骨质显示清晰的分别为33例、22例和4例(χ^2=35.93,P〈0.01)。结论:对于鼻骨整体、周边软组织及前颅窝骨质的显示优化参数后的EVP影像明显强于原始EVP参数影像及非EVP影像。

Application of EVP in Digital Radiography of Nasal Bone

Abstract:Objective.. To discuss the value of enhanced visualization image processing (EVP) in digitizing image processing of lateral view of nasal bone. Methods:Different EVP parameters were used to process the digital images of lateral view of nasal bone in 50 cases. The processed images of nasal bone, soft tissue of nasal bone and anterior cranial fossa bone were evaluated by two experienced radiologists. Results: The processed digital images of the whole nasal bone with modified-EVP, original-EVP and non-EVP could be discerned in 44,35,19 cases (χ^2= 28.32, P〈0.01) respectively, those of the soft tissues of nasal bone were 41,31,12 cases (χ^2=35.23, P〈0.01) respectively, and those of the anterior cranial fossa bone were 33,22,4 cases (χ^2 = 35. 9, P〈 0.01 ) respectively. Conclusion: The quality of modified-- EVP images is better than the original-EVP and non-EVP images in displaying nasal bone, soft tissue of nasal bone and anterior cranial fossa bone.
